The Great Pyramid of Cholula in Mexico, despite being overlooked as a natural hill, is recognized by Guinness World Records as the largest pyramid by volume, surpassing Egypt's Great Pyramid of Giza.

Medieval Seal of Edward the Confessor Discovered in French National Archives After 40 Years

A rare 11th-century royal seal belonging to Edward the Confessor has been rediscovered in the French National Archives in Paris after being missing for over 40 years. The beeswax seal, dating to the 1050s and originally attached to a document from the Abbey of Saint-Denis, is the only complete example of its design from before the Norman Conquest. Dr Guilhem Dorandeu of the University of Exeter found the artefact while examining medieval documents, calling it a 'career-defining moment.' The seal depicts Edward on a throne with Byzantine-inspired symbols, revealing that complex administrative practices credited to the Normans were already developed during his reign.
